What special fishing regulations apply at Lake Borgne + Mississippi Sound (St. Bernard / Plaquemines)?
Lake Borgne + Mississippi Sound (St. Bernard / Plaquemines) carries one special-regulation overlay that overrides Louisiana's statewide 2026 rules. It reads: "Saltwater Recreational Licence — speckled trout, redfish, sheepshead, flounder; tidal estuary." Every overlay on this water body is listed in full above.
Do I need a fishing license to fish Lake Borgne + Mississippi Sound (St. Bernard / Plaquemines)?
Yes. Lake Borgne + Mississippi Sound (St. Bernard / Plaquemines) is in Louisiana, so a valid Louisiana fishing license is required just as it is anywhere else in the state, issued by Louisiana Department of Wildlife & Fisheries. The special regulations on this page change the bag, size, slot, or gear rules for Lake Borgne + Mississippi Sound; they do not waive the license requirement. Free-fishing days and youth exemptions follow the statewide Louisiana rules.
Do Lake Borgne + Mississippi Sound (St. Bernard / Plaquemines)'s special rules replace Louisiana's statewide limits?
Only where they conflict. Louisiana's statewide 2026 regulations apply on Lake Borgne + Mississippi Sound by default; the overlays above replace the matching statewide rule for the species or gear they name, while everything not specifically overridden still follows the statewide rule. When a water-body rule and the statewide rule disagree, the water-body rule wins.
